1. Product Description

The GE Fanuc IC693PWR324 is a high-performance power supply module designed for industrial automation systems, providing reliable and stable power distribution for GE Fanuc PLC platforms. As a critical component in control systems, the IC693PWR324 ensures consistent voltage regulation and efficient power management, supporting seamless operation of digital and analog modules in harsh industrial environments. With a compact design and advanced safety features, this module is ideal for applications requiring continuous uptime and robust power delivery. The IC693PWR324 integrates seamlessly with GE Fanuc’s Series 90-30 PLCs, delivering compatibility and ease of installation for retrofits or new projects.

2. Product Parameters

Parameter Specification
Input Voltage 100–240 VAC (±10%), 50/60 Hz
Output Voltage 24 VDC (±0.5 V)
Output Current 5 A
Power Rating 120 W
Efficiency Up to 90% (满载)
Operating Temperature -20°C to +60°C
Dimensions (W×H×D) 100 mm × 160 mm × 120 mm
Compatibility GE Fanuc Series 90-30 PLC systems

6. Selection Recommendations

  • Compatibility: Ensure compatibility with GE Fanuc Series 90-30 PLC racks (e.g., IC693CHS393).
  • Power Requirements: Calculate total system power (sum of module currents) to avoid overloading.
  • Environment: Select models with extended temperature ranges (-40°C to +70°C) for extreme climates.
  • Budget: Balance upfront costs with long-term savings (e.g., energy efficiency and reduced downtime).

7. Precautions

  • Installation: Follow ESD (electrostatic discharge) protocols; use anti-static wrist straps.
  • Ventilation: Ensure adequate airflow to maintain operating temperature (<60°C).
  • Maintenance: Inspect capacitors annually for swelling or leakage; replace every 5–7 years for optimal performance.
  • Safety: Disconnect input power before servicing; verify voltage levels with a multimeter.
